Mustang 2800 Series II, launched in 2001 and powered by a Volvo 5.7 lt V8 with duo-prop. Engine and stern-drive replaced in 2016.
Accommodation includes 2 double berths, enclosed bathroom with portable toilet and hot shower, galley with stove-top and fridge, plus the huge cockpit with plenty of entertaining space.
Inventory includes Garmin GPS, Panasonic sound system, 27 meg radio, shore power, solar panel, 4 batteries, hydraulic steering, trim tabs, and full camping covers with shades.
A good example of these popular Australian built mid-sized sports cruisers.
Very good condition throughout.
